Every team is going to overpay a player. LSU, Mizzou, Bama, OU, and every team in the SEC is overpaying for players. If they miss on DT, but still need to fill that position they are going to over pay the next available DT. The next available DT might be making more than the 5 DT’s rated higher than him.

Team’s will need to overpay to fill a hole in their roster and there’s nothing wrong with that. BK is kinda right, but he is also a little wrong.
